Subject: Renewal of Corporate Insurance Programme — Detailed Summary

Dear colleagues,

Our combined policy with Arbenfield Assurance is due for renewal on 30 April. The proposed premium reflects a 7.4% increase, driven chiefly by revised flood-risk ratings at the Colmere warehouse. Cover limits remain unchanged; the deductible on marine cargo rises slightly. Finance should accrue the difference from Q2 onward and confirm the payment schedule with treasury.

A full broker comparison is attached for review.

The note below explains the timing.

board note of yagap-fahop: The northern region missed its Julix quota by 6.7 percent last quarter. Goroxix Partners plans to raise the Caswyn list price by 6.7 percent in April. The board signed off on a budget of $201.2 million for Project Gilath. The renewal with Zoriusax Group closes at $431.5 million a year, 51.5 percent below the last contract.

Ticket: Read-replica lag alarm keeps firing on the Quillbase cluster. Heads up, support folks — the lag spikes every night around the batch window, hits ~40s, then recovers on its own. We've bumped the alarm threshold to 60s and added a note to the runbook so you don't get paged for nothing. Before we close this out, it needs a formal sign-off. The person who has to approve the threshold change is named below.

approver of fahap-tahag = Silir Ralax Ralvan

### Catalogue Import Pipeline (Thornbury Library System)

The nightly import pulls MARC-style records from the Quillmere feed, normalises them, and upserts into the catalogue store in batches. Batch sizing matters: too large and the deduplication pass exhausts memory on the smaller worker tier; too small and the run overshoots the maintenance window. Future maintainers should adjust cautiously and re-run the staging benchmark after any change. The current tuning values are listed below.

tuning constants:
BUDGETS = {
    "druath": 240,
    "lamwyn": 180,
    "silael": 275,
}